Porch Carpentry in Redmond, WA
Porch carpentry services encompass the construction, repair, and enhancement of outdoor porch structures, including steps, railings, columns, and flooring. These projects often involve creating inviting entryways, updating existing porches, or adding new features to improve curb appeal and functionality. Homeowners typically seek this service to ensure their porch is both attractive and safe, with attention to detail in craftsmanship and material selection to match the style of the home.
Property owners considering porch carpentry usually want to understand the scope of work, materials used, and any design options available to complement their property. It’s important to clarify project goals, desired materials, and budget considerations beforehand. Proper planning ensures the finished porch enhances the home's appearance and provides durable, long-lasting outdoor space for relaxing or entertaining.

Porch Carpentry Questions
What types of porch carpentry projects are common? Typical projects include porch framing, railing installation, steps, and decorative trim work to enhance curb appeal and functionality.
How can porch carpentry improve property value? Well-designed and sturdy porch features can boost curb appeal and create inviting outdoor spaces for residents and visitors.
What materials are used in porch carpentry? Common materials include treated wood, cedar, composite decking, and decorative trim to match the property's style and durability needs.
What should property owners consider when planning porch carpentry? It's important to think about the porch's purpose, style, and how it complements the overall property design for a cohesive look.
